Introduction of Titanium Balls:
Titanium balls are spherical metallic components made primarily from titanium or titanium alloys. They are precision-engineered to exacting standards and find application in a wide range of industries due to titanium's unique properties.
Properties of Titanium Balls:
Corrosion Resistance: Titanium and its alloys exhibit exceptional resistance to corrosion, especially in aggressive environments such as seawater and chemical processing plants. This property makes titanium balls suitable for applications where durability and longevity are crucial.
Lightweight: Titanium is known for its low density, making titanium balls lightweight compared to steel or other metals of similar strength. This characteristic is advantageous in applications where weight reduction is desired, such as aerospace and automotive industries.
High Strength: Despite its low density, titanium alloys offer high strength comparable to some steels. This strength-to-weight ratio makes titanium balls capable of withstanding high loads and pressures.
Biocompatibility: Titanium is biocompatible and non-toxic, making titanium balls suitable for medical applications such as surgical implants, prosthetics, and dental instruments. They integrate well with human tissues without adverse reactions.
Heat and Cold Resistance: Titanium maintains its mechanical properties over a wide temperature range, from cryogenic temperatures to moderately high temperatures. This thermal stability makes titanium balls suitable for use in various thermal and mechanical applications.

Chemical Composition:
Composition (%) | Fe | C | N | H | O | Al | V | Ti |
Titanium Grade 5 | ≤0.30 | ≤0.10 | ≤0.05 | ≤0.015 | ≤0.20 | 5.50-6.80 | 3.50-4.50 | Bal. |
Composition(%) | Ti | N | C | H | Fe | O | | |
Titanium Grade GR7 | Bal. | ≤0.03 | ≤0.08 | ≤0.013 | ≤0.25 | ≤0.15 | |

Differences between Grade 2 and Grade 5:
Titanium Grade 2 and Grade 5 (Ti-6Al-4V) are two of the most commonly used titanium alloys, but they have significant differences in terms of composition, properties, and typical applications. Below is a comparison of the two grades:
Grade 2 (Commercially Pure Titanium):
Grade 2 is a commercially pure titanium alloy with very little alloying elements. It is primarily composed of titanium, making it a relatively soft and ductile material compared to alloyed grades.
Grade 5 (Ti-6Al-4V):
Grade 5 is an alloyed titanium (specifically Ti-6Al-4V), which includes aluminum and vanadium as primary alloying elements. These additions give it higher strength, hardness, and other enhanced properties compared to pure titanium (Grade 2).
